Technical Search Engine Optimization and Site Architecture

Technical search engine optimization creates the underlying platform infrastructure that allows search engine spiders to crawl, analyze, and index website pages efficiently. Technical flaws prevent search engine algorithms from properly ranking even high-quality written articles.

Page Speed and Server Infrastructure

Website loading speed serves as a direct search engine ranking factor and strongly influences user retention. Slow page loading times frustrate site visitors, leading to high bounce rates and lower search engine positions. Server response times must remain fast under varied traffic loads. Compressing images, enabling browser caching, minifying JavaScript files, and utilizing Content Delivery Networks accelerate page render speeds. Fast-loading pages encourage visitors to read multiple articles and send positive performance signals to search algorithms.

Mobile Responsiveness and Core Web Vitals

A major share of internet searches originates from mobile devices like smartphones and tablets. Search engines evaluate web pages using mobile-first indexing, meaning the mobile version of Zingyzon determines search engine ranking positions. Web pages must feature responsive layouts that adjust smoothly across all screen sizes. Core Web Vitals measure specific mobile performance criteria, including loading speed, visual stability, and interaction responsiveness. Preventing visual layout shifts during page loading ensures a stable reading experience for mobile users.

Crawlability, Sitemaps, and Indexation Speed

Search engine crawlers discover website pages by navigating internal hyperlinks and reading XML sitemaps. Maintaining an updated XML sitemap ensures search engines discover newly published articles quickly. Eliminating broken 404 links, removing duplicate content, and configuring proper robots.txt directives preserve search crawler resources. A fully optimized web page featuring clean technical code and accurate meta tags can achieve search engine indexation within three to six hours.

Keyword Research Framework and Content Mapping

Keyword research identifies the specific words, search phrases, and online questions entered by prospective readers into search engines. Mapping these keywords to dedicated pages on Zingyzon ensures systematic topic coverage without keyword self-competition.

Identifying High-Intent Seed Keywords

Keyword research begins by gathering foundational seed keywords across all target categories, including technology, business, and consumer lifestyle. Automated research tools extract search volume estimates and difficulty scores for these terms. Categorizing seed terms by searcher intent allows content managers to structure focused article outlines. High-intent seed terms point directly to the primary problems readers need solved.

Targeting Low-Competition Long-Tail Queries

Broad keywords carry high monthly search volumes but face intense competition from established media outlets. Focusing on long-tail keywords provides a faster path to organic search visibility. Long-tail terms consist of longer, highly specific search phrases. These terms carry lower individual search volumes but feature minimal ranking competition and high user conversion rates. Publishing well-structured articles on specific long-tail queries allows Zingyzon to reach top search positions quickly without needing massive backlink profiles. Compounding hundreds of ranking long-tail articles generates reliable, long-term organic traffic growth.

Semantic Keyword Placement and Keyword Mapping

Modern search engine algorithms use natural language processing models to evaluate context rather than matching exact phrase repetitions. Primary target keywords should be placed naturally within the first one hundred words of the text, inside the main title tag, and within primary sub-headings. Secondary keywords, conceptual synonyms, and related topical terms should be distributed naturally throughout body paragraphs. This semantic approach provides complete topical coverage while preventing keyword stuffing penalties.

On-Page Optimization Standards and Execution

On-page search engine optimization focuses on structuring page elements to communicate topical relevance to search engine crawlers while offering a smooth reading experience to website visitors.

Writing Click-Worthy Title Tags and Meta Descriptions

The title tag and meta description form the primary search result snippet displayed to users on search engine result pages. Title tags directly influence search rankings and click-through rates. Title tags must remain under seventy characters to prevent truncation on search screens. The primary target keyword should be positioned near the beginning of the title tag. Meta descriptions should stay under one hundred seventy-five characters, summarize page content accurately, and include a clear call to action that invites clicks.

Hierarchical Heading Structures and Paragraph Formatting

Organizing articles with hierarchical headings ranging from H1 to H3 makes content easy to navigate for readers and easy to parse for crawlers. The H1 tag serves as the main title and should appear once per page. H2 tags designate major sub-topics, while H3 tags divide secondary details within an H2 section. Body paragraphs must remain concise, ideally spanning two to four short sentences. Short sentences reduce reader fatigue, lower bounce rates, and improve content legibility scores.

Image Optimization and Alt Text Attributes

Search engine crawlers cannot process visual content without textual descriptions. Every image embedded in an article requires an alternative text attribute describing the visual subject matter while incorporating target keywords naturally. Image file names should use descriptive words separated by hyphens rather than default camera labels. Compressing image files reduces page rendering times, supporting overall site speed goals.

Structured Data and Generative Engine Optimization

Search engines increasingly rely on artificial intelligence models to understand page content and deliver direct summary answers to searchers. Implementing structured code standards ensures Zingyzon remains visible across traditional search results and modern artificial intelligence platforms.

Schema Markup Implementation for Higher Visibility

Structured data uses JSON-LD code formats to give search engines explicit contextual details about website pages. Adding structured schema tags helps search algorithms display rich snippet features, star review ratings, and expandable answer boxes in search results. Implementing Article schema identifies publication dates, author details, and news headlines. Implementing FAQPage schema allows search engines to pull questions and answers directly into search engine snippet panels, driving higher organic click-through rates.

Optimizing Content for Artificial Intelligence Search Engines

Artificial intelligence search tools like ChatGPT, Perplexity, and Google AI Overviews synthesize web information to answer user queries directly. Generative Engine Optimization ensures that website content is easily processed, summarized, and cited by these artificial intelligence systems. Artificial intelligence models favor content backed by verified facts, concise summary blocks, clean formatting tables, and clear topic organization. Placing direct factual answers at the top of article sections makes it easy for AI engines to extract Zingyzon as a cited reference source.

Entity Recognition and Knowledge Graph Alignment

Search engine algorithms build internal knowledge graphs connecting recognized entities such as brands, individuals, software, and concepts. Zingyzon can strengthen its entity profile by maintaining consistent brand details, linking internally to related topic hubs, and linking externally to recognized industry sources. Clear entity association confirms site legitimacy and supports higher domain trust scores across search algorithms.

Off-Page Optimization and Strategic Backlink Acquisition

Off-page search engine optimization establishes domain authority through external validation. Backlinks from external, high-quality websites signal trust to search algorithms, driving ranking improvements across all published pages.

Earning Authoritative Inbound Links

Backlinks act as structural votes of confidence within search engine ranking algorithms. Quality holds far more value than link volume. Obtaining a single backlink from an established news portal or recognized tech site delivers greater ranking value than dozens of low-quality directory links. Creating link-worthy content assets, such as comprehensive research summaries, detailed technical guides, and industry comparative studies, encourages other blogs to reference Zingyzon naturally. Conducting direct outreach to blog editors and technology journalists helps secure organic backlink placements.

Digital Public Relations and Brand Mentions

Digital public relations strategies focus on building brand visibility across mainstream media outlets and digital publications. Search algorithms monitor brand references across the web to gauge site popularity and market presence. Securing coverage in industry news reports builds brand trust. When digital publications mention Zingyzon without including an active hyperlink, conducting polite outreach to editors can convert plain brand mentions into high-value backlinks.

Internal Link Architecture and Page Authority Distribution

Internal linking connects pages within Zingyzon, distributing page authority throughout the website. High-authority pages, such as popular technology guides or the homepage, pass link equity to newer articles through targeted internal links. Internal links must use descriptive anchor text that informs search crawlers and human readers about the target page content. Strategic internal linking builds organized topic clusters, reinforcing overall topical authority across key categories.

Advanced Content Architecture and Topic Clustering

Establishing comprehensive topic clusters allows Zingyzon to dominate multi-topic niches by grouping related content assets around central resource hubs.

Designing Core Pillar Pages

A pillar page serves as an exhaustive, high-level overview of a broad subject, such as cybersecurity guidelines or digital business strategies. The pillar page covers essential concepts briefly while linking out to detailed sub-topic articles. Pillar pages target high-volume broad keywords and act as primary landing pages for visitors arriving from search engines.

Constructing Supporting Cluster Content

Supporting cluster articles explore specific sub-topics outlined on the central pillar page. For example, a supporting cluster article within cybersecurity might cover two-factor authentication or virtual private networks in extreme technical detail. Each cluster article links directly back to the main pillar page using exact anchor text, while also linking laterally to related cluster articles. This interlinked structure demonstrates complete topical mastery to search algorithms.
